Comprehending Gaskets
Gaskets are designed to fill the area in between two or more mating surfaces, guaranteeing a tight seal. Their main function is to prevent the escape of fluids or gases, which could cause inefficient operation or hazardous situations. When a gasket stops working, it can trigger leaks, increased friction, and even engine or machinery failure.

Changing a gasket seal can be a manageable task for those with the right tools and understanding. Here is a step-by-step guide:
Tools and Materials NeededNew gasketGasket scraper or razor bladeTorque wrenchSocket setCleaning up solventRagsGlovesSecurity gogglesSteps for Replacement
Preparation: Ensure the maker is cool and all power sources are shut off. Use security goggles and gloves.
Remove the Component: Carefully detach the part where the gasket lies. This may include unbolting or unscrewing different parts of the equipment.
Clean the Surface: Use a gasket scraper or razor blade to thoroughly eliminate the old gasket product from the mating surfaces. Clean the area with a solvent to eliminate any particles or oil.
Check for Damage: Before installing the brand-new gasket, check the breeding surface areas for any indications of wear or damage. If they are not smooth or perhaps, repair work may be essential.
Set Up the New Door Gasket Replacement: Position the brand-new gasket on the tidy, dry surface. Ensure it is lined up correctly and fits snugly in location.
Reattach the Component: Carefully reattach the part. Utilize a torque wrench to tighten bolts to the maker's specifications, making sure even pressure to prevent warping.
Test the System: Once everything is reassembled, turn on the equipment and screen for leakages or issues.

Neglecting a harmed gasket can lead to severe leaks, reduced efficiency, and eventually, mechanical failure. It can likewise lead to potential security dangers.
How typically should gaskets be examined or changed?
It is suggested to inspect gaskets frequently, specifically in high-use applications. Replacement ought to happen as quickly as indications of wear or leaks are detected.
Can I utilize any gasket material for replacement?
No. Gaskets are particularly created for particular applications and conditions. Always ensure you use the recommended material for your particular machinery or system.
Is gasket replacement a DIY task?
Numerous people can change gaskets themselves if they have the right tools and experience. However, complex systems may require expert expertise.
